Let α\alpha be a solution of x2+x+1=0x^2 + x + 1 = 0, and for some aa and bb in R\mathbb{R},

[4ab][116131122148]=[000]\begin{bmatrix} 4 & a & b \end{bmatrix} \begin{bmatrix} 1 & 16 & 13 \\ -1 & -1 & 2 \\ -2 & -14 & -8 \end{bmatrix} = \begin{bmatrix} 0 & 0 & 0 \end{bmatrix}

If 4α4+mαa+nαb=3\frac{4}{\alpha^4} + \frac{m}{\alpha^a} + \frac{n}{\alpha^b} = 3, then m+nm + n is equal to _____.

  • A

    1111

  • B

    77

  • C

    88

  • D

    33
